At your darkest



No matter how big your regrets are - know this:



I cannot surprise Jesus with my failure
with my mess, 
 with my willful, foolish unfaithfulness.


There's nothing Satan can bring up that he doesn't already know.

So when ... much too late
 I scramble back onto my feet, swallow hard and finally, haltingly

shove the words out of my mouth

He says:

"Catherine, I already know.
I already know.
And I paid for that. 
There is no more shame. No more wrath for you to face. 

No more guilt.

There is no condemnation.

It's gone.

And when I look at those moments in your life it is not with begrudging frustration. 
It is not with disappointment. 

I do not roll my eyes. There is no hostility in my gaze. 

Yes, your sin has created distance between us, but it is a distance I have already swallowed up at the cross.*

I loved you at your darkest."





"But God demonstrates his love for us in this: while we were still sinners, Christ died for us." 
Romans 5:8







(*"Neither will I condemn you. Go and sin no more." John 8:11)
